Output 4577f001cdcec31686e86c83f3b2a85be23a9b3c8ea5b752e63f6d2817618d4d:1

value
23728126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b8f1bf3cd8b2128b2bd9a6fe218d6232dfb79f4 OP_EQUAL
address
3PAYA2PEFnksMBP68jFS2WhrMvirD2VbDK
transaction
4577f001cdcec31686e86c83f3b2a85be23a9b3c8ea5b752e63f6d2817618d4d
spent
true